Transaction 8ab790942579300ce5bc717562706c9781c5ac6c5a5fc463d41f77122a3435d6
1 Input
1 Output
-
8ab790942579300ce5bc717562706c9781c5ac6c5a5fc463d41f77122a3435d6:0
- value
- 34899246
- script pubkey
- OP_0 OP_PUSHBYTES_20 65327114ff0050433a657d2571258efa59831d8d
- address
- bc1qv5e8z98lqpgyxwn905jhzfvwlfvcx8vde303a7